Possible Risks



Prior to undertaking cataract surgery, it is essential for you to comprehend the possible dangers entailed. While cataract surgical treatment is normally risk-free, like any surgical procedure, it brings some risks.

One possible danger is infection. Although uncommon, it can occur and might require additional therapy with anti-biotics.

An additional risk is swelling or swelling of the eye, which might create temporary blurred vision.

In some cases, the lens pill, which holds the synthetic lens in position, can become cloudy after surgical treatment, resulting in blurry vision. This problem, called posterior pill opacification, can be easily treated with a fast laser procedure.

Lastly, there's a small risk of retinal detachment, which may require additional surgery to fix.

It is necessary to go over these possible risks with your eye surgeon to make a notified decision regarding the surgical treatment.

Benefits of Cataract Surgery



If you go through cataract surgical procedure, you can anticipate numerous benefits. One of the primary advantages is boosted vision. Cataracts cause fuzzy vision, and the surgical treatment removes the cloudy lens, enabling light to enter the eye effectively. This brings about clearer and sharper vision, allowing you to see items and details more accurately.




One more advantage is the remediation of shade perception. Cataracts can create shades to show up faded or yellowish, yet after surgical treatment, colors will show up a lot more vibrant and lifelike.

Additionally, cataract surgical procedure can reduce glow and improve night vision, making activities such as driving at night much safer and extra comfortable.
